URL: https://github.com/llvm/llvm-project/commit/666098c5b3ea6e01ffe9e827064c26dfaaf9c655 DIFF: https://github.com/llvm/llvm-project/commit/666098c5b3ea6e01ffe9e827064c26dfaaf9c655.diff LOG: [Headers] Remove musl-related comment about NULL This removes a comment added in D159312, which warned people to not re-add a whitespace in the `((void*)0))` expression. After discussions happened in D159312, it doesn't seem like a permanent solution. While I'd like to keep the whitespace removed for now, given that at least it can be a band-aid to some users who use musl and clang's `stddef.h` at the same time, it seems the usage of them together is not something that's officially supported, and I should not be implying this should be the permanent solution by saying so in the comments.
